Explore Colorado's rich skiing and snowboarding heritage at this free museum featuring interactive exhibits on the legendary 10th Mountain Division, Olympic champions, and the evolution of winter sports—perfect for history buffs and snow sports enthusiasts alike.
Discover the soaring 200-foot East Vail Falls via an easy roadside stroll or thrilling rope-assisted climb, a protected landmark perfect for quick hikes, birdwatching, and winter ice climbing. Adventure seekers, families, and nature lovers will love its accessible beauty off I-70 in Vail.[1][3][7]
